Armenia: Nature’s Gem in the South Caucasus

Armenia, nestled in the South Caucasus, boasts breathtaking natural landscapes. The capital, Yerevan, is a blend of culture and scenic beauty. Explore vibrant markets alongside traditional Armenian flavors.

Azerbaijan: Where East Meets West

Azerbaijan, straddling Europe and Asia, is a fusion of modernity and ancient wonders. With its medieval structures like the Shirvanshahs’ Palace, Baku, the capital is a must-visit. Indulge in culinary delights like Plov and Kebabs.

Georgia: A Symphony of Nature and Culture

With its mesmerizing natural landscapes and warm hospitality, Georgia is a perfect destination. Visit Mtskheta and Uplistikhe to witness ancient wonders and savor traditional Georgian dishes.

Hong Kong: Where Tradition Meets Skyscrapers

Hong Kong, an East-meets-West metropolis, is adorned with skyscrapers and ancient traditions. Explore Mong Kok for vibrant markets and Victoria Peak for historical cityscapes.

Kyrgyzstan: Adventure Amidst Mountains

For adventure seekers, Kyrgyzstan is a mountainous paradise. The Tian Shan Mountains and the ancient city of Karakol offer breathtaking views and trekking adventures.

Malaysia: Cultural Kaleidoscope

Malaysia is a tapestry of cultures and breathtaking scenery. Kuala Lumpur’s Skyline and Penang’s street markets are a sensory treat. Enjoy diverse culinary experiences with dishes like Nasi Lemak.

Maldives: Crystal Clear Paradise

With its crystal-clear waters and overwater bungalows, the Maldives is a tropical dream. Immerse yourself in the stunning marine life and relax on pristine white-sand beaches.

Mauritius: Nature’s Wonderland in the Indian Ocean

Mauritius, nestled in the Indian Ocean, is a haven of natural beauty. Explore the Black River Gorges National Park and marvel at the Seven Colored Earths in Chamarel.

Montenegro: Adriatic Gem

Montenegro, with its fjord-like Bay of Kotor, is a fantasy-like destination. The medieval town of Kotor and the Durmitor National Park offer a perfect blend of history and natural wonders.

Nepal: Himalayan Marvels

Nepal, home to the majestic Himalayas, beckons with its stunning landscapes. Kathmandu’s temples and the Everest Base Camp trek provide a unique cultural and adventurous experience.

Seychelles: Paradise on Earth

Seychelles, an African paradise, boasts lush jungles and pristine beaches. Explore Mahé’s stunning Mahé and Vallée de Mai for a glimpse of rare Coco de Mer palms.
